Coral Beauty Angelfish - Names & Recognition

The Coral Beauty Angelfish holds its place as one of the most recognizable and beloved dwarf angelfish in the marine aquarium hobby. Known scientifically as Centropyge bispinosa, this species belongs to the family Pomacanthidae, which encompasses all marine angelfish. The genus name Centropyge derives from Greek roots meaning "thorn" and "rump," referencing the characteristic spine found on the gill cover of dwarf angelfish species.

The common name "Coral Beauty" perfectly captures the essence of this species, highlighting both its preferred coral reef habitat and its undeniable visual appeal. The alternate name "Twospined Angelfish" references the prominent preopercular spines characteristic of the Centropyge genus, distinguishing these dwarf angels from their larger Pomacanthus relatives.

Within the aquarium trade, regional variations have led to additional informal names including the Dusky Angelfish and Two-spined Angelfish. Specimens from different collection localities sometimes receive geographic designations, as coloration can vary somewhat between populations across their Indo-Pacific range. Fiji and Vanuatu specimens often command premium prices due to particularly vibrant coloration.

The species was first scientifically described by Gรผnther in 1860, establishing its place in ichthyological literature well over a century ago. Despite this long scientific history, Coral Beauties only gained widespread aquarium popularity as marine fishkeeping technology advanced through the latter twentieth century.

Coral Beauty Angelfish Physical Description

The Coral Beauty Angelfish presents a striking visual display that immediately captures attention in any marine aquarium. Adult specimens typically reach 3 to 4 inches in total length, placing them firmly within the dwarf angelfish category while still providing substantial visual impact. Their laterally compressed, disc-shaped body follows the classic angelfish profile, allowing effortless maneuvering through complex reef structures.

Coloration varies somewhat between individuals and collection localities, but the characteristic pattern remains consistent. The body displays a rich combination of deep blue to purple hues overlaid with vibrant orange to reddish-orange markings. The head and face region typically show more orange coloration, transitioning to darker purple-blue across the flanks. Vertical dark bars or striations break up the pattern, providing excellent camouflage against reef backgrounds.

The dorsal and anal fins extend prominently, displaying the same blue-purple base coloration with orange highlights near the body. These fins feature darker margins that frame the fish beautifully when fully extended. The caudal fin maintains the purple-blue theme with subtle orange accents, completing the harmonious color scheme. Pectoral fins remain largely transparent with slight yellow tinting.

Juvenile Coral Beauties display similar patterning to adults, though colors may appear somewhat muted until maturity. As fish mature and establish territories, coloration typically intensifies, with dominant individuals often showing the most vibrant hues. Sexual dimorphism remains subtle in this species, with males potentially growing slightly larger and displaying marginally more intense coloration, though reliable visual sexing proves difficult.

The characteristic Centropyge preopercular spine sits prominently on the gill cover, serving as both a defensive weapon and distinguishing feature. Eyes appear proportionally large, positioned high on the head for excellent all-around vision essential for detecting both predators and food sources on the reef.

Natural Habitat & Range

Coral Beauty Angelfish inhabit the warm tropical waters of the Indo-Pacific region, ranging from East Africa across to the islands of the central Pacific. Their distribution encompasses major reef systems including those surrounding Indonesia, the Philippines, Fiji, Vanuatu, the Marshall Islands, and the Great Barrier Reef. This extensive range makes them one of the most widely distributed Centropyge species.

In their natural environment, Coral Beauties favor outer reef slopes and lagoon patch reefs where healthy coral growth provides abundant structure and food sources. They typically occupy depths between 15 and 150 feet, though most commonly encountered between 30 and 90 feet where water conditions remain stable and food resources prove abundant. These depths offer protection from surface disturbances while maintaining access to productive reef zones.

Their preferred microhabitat consists of areas with extensive live rock and coral coverage providing numerous crevices and caves for shelter. Coral Beauties establish territories centered around specific rock formations, defending these areas from conspecifics while sharing space with other reef fish species. Territories typically span 20 to 30 square feet, encompassing multiple hiding spots and grazing surfaces.

Wild specimens inhabit waters maintaining temperatures between 74 and 82 degrees Fahrenheit with stable salinity around 35 parts per thousand. Natural reef environments provide consistent pH levels between 8.1 and 8.4, with strong water movement ensuring excellent oxygenation. These fish experience consistent day-night cycles near the equator, with approximately twelve hours each of light and darkness year-round.

The substrate in their natural habitat typically consists of coral rubble and sand interspersed among rock formations. Algae growth on hard surfaces provides essential grazing opportunities, with Coral Beauties spending significant portions of each day browsing these surfaces for food. Their habitat supports diverse invertebrate and algae communities that form the foundation of their natural diet.

Coral Beauty Angelfish Temperament & Behavior

Understanding the behavioral patterns of Coral Beauty Angelfish proves essential for successful long-term care and appropriate tank mate selection. These fish display the characteristic semi-aggressive temperament common to dwarf angelfish, establishing and defending territories with moderate intensity while generally tolerating dissimilar species within their space.

Territorial behavior manifests most strongly toward conspecifics and closely related Centropyge species. Housing multiple Coral Beauties typically leads to constant aggression unless provided with extensive space exceeding 150 gallons with abundant visual barriers. In smaller systems, dominant individuals relentlessly harass subordinates, often to the point of causing severe stress or death. This territorial drive extends to other dwarf angelfish species, making mixed Centropyge collections challenging.

Toward unrelated tank mates, Coral Beauties display considerably more tolerance. They coexist peacefully with clownfish, gobies, blennies, and most other common reef inhabitants. Larger tangs and wrasses generally receive little attention beyond brief territorial displays when initially introduced. The key lies in selecting species dissimilar in appearance and behavior, avoiding fish that might trigger competitive responses.

Daily activity patterns center around grazing behavior and territory patrol. Coral Beauties remain active throughout daylight hours, constantly picking at rockwork surfaces and investigating their environment. They swim with purposeful movements, rarely remaining stationary for extended periods except when resting within protective rockwork at night. This constant motion adds dynamic visual interest to display aquariums.

During the acclimation period following introduction, Coral Beauties may initially hide extensively, gradually emerging as they become comfortable with their surroundings. This adjustment phase typically lasts one to three weeks, during which feeding response and activity levels progressively increase. Providing adequate hiding spots accelerates this process by reducing stress.

Breeding behavior in captivity rarely occurs, but hormonal changes can intensify aggression in mature specimens. Established individuals may become increasingly territorial as they age, sometimes developing intolerance toward tank mates previously ignored. Monitoring long-term behavioral changes helps identify potential problems before serious conflict develops.

Tank Setup & Requirements

Creating an appropriate environment for Coral Beauty Angelfish requires careful attention to tank size, aquascape design, and equipment selection. These active fish demand adequate swimming space combined with complex rockwork providing territories, hiding spots, and grazing surfaces. Proper setup establishes the foundation for long-term health and natural behavior expression.

A minimum tank size of 70 gallons accommodates a single Coral Beauty, though larger systems of 100 gallons or more prove preferable for long-term success. Tank dimensions matter significantly, with longer footprints providing better swimming space and territory options than tall, narrow configurations. A 4-foot or longer tank offers ideal proportions for these active swimmers.

Live rock forms the cornerstone of proper habitat design, serving multiple functions including biological filtration, territory establishment, and food production. Arrange 50 to 75 pounds of quality live rock to create a complex structure with numerous caves, overhangs, and swim-through passages. Avoid stacking rock directly against back glass, instead creating depth and swimming channels throughout the aquascape.

Filtration requirements for Coral Beauties follow standard marine guidelines, with emphasis on biological capacity and water movement. A quality protein skimmer sized appropriately for tank volume removes dissolved organics before they decompose. Supplemental biological filtration through sumps or canister filters provides additional processing capacity. Target total system turnover of 10 to 20 times tank volume hourly.

Water movement should replicate natural reef conditions without creating excessive laminar flow. Powerheads or wavemakers positioned to create varied current patterns encourage natural grazing behavior while preventing dead spots where detritus accumulates. Coral Beauties appreciate moderate to strong flow but require calmer zones for resting and feeding.

Lighting requirements remain flexible, as these fish lack specific photoperiod needs beyond maintaining stable day-night cycles. Standard reef lighting suitable for coral growth or fish-only illumination both prove acceptable. Ensure gradual ramp-up and ramp-down periods to simulate natural dawn and dusk, reducing startle responses during light transitions.

Substrate selection matters less for the fish themselves than for overall system health and aesthetics. Fine to medium aragonite sand between 1 and 3 inches deep supports beneficial bacteria while preventing nutrient accumulation. Some aquarists successfully maintain bare-bottom systems, though Coral Beauties show no strong preference either way.

Water Parameters

Maintaining stable, high-quality water conditions proves essential for keeping Coral Beauty Angelfish healthy and thriving. While this species demonstrates greater tolerance for parameter variation than many marine fish, consistent optimal conditions support vibrant coloration, strong immune function, and maximum longevity. Understanding target parameters and maintenance requirements prevents stress-related health issues.

Temperature should remain stable between 72 and 78 degrees Fahrenheit, with 75 to 76 degrees representing the ideal target for most systems. Temperature swings exceeding 2 degrees within 24 hours stress fish and compromise immune function. Quality heaters with reliable thermostats, combined with ambient room temperature control, maintain necessary stability. Consider backup heating for critical situations.

pH levels must remain within the marine-appropriate range of 8.1 to 8.4, with 8.2 to 8.3 representing optimal targets. Regular testing using quality test kits catches pH drift before problems develop. Alkalinity maintenance between 8 and 12 dKH stabilizes pH, preventing the gradual decline common in closed marine systems. Buffer additions may prove necessary based on testing results.

Specific gravity should remain consistent between 1.020 and 1.025, with 1.024 to 1.025 matching natural ocean conditions. Refractometers provide more accurate salinity measurement than swing-arm hydrometers, reducing error potential. Top-off systems using purified freshwater maintain stable salinity as evaporation occurs, preventing dangerous concentration increases.

Ammonia and nitrite must remain undetectable at all times, as any measurable levels indicate serious biological filtration problems requiring immediate attention. Nitrate levels below 20 ppm support health, though keeping concentrations under 10 ppm proves preferable for long-term success. Regular water changes of 10 to 20 percent weekly or biweekly maintain low nitrate while replenishing trace elements.

Water changes using properly prepared synthetic saltwater form the foundation of ongoing maintenance. Mix salt at least 24 hours before use, ensuring complete dissolution and temperature matching. Quality reverse osmosis or deionized water prevents introducing contaminants common in tap water. Siphon detritus from substrate surfaces during changes to reduce organic accumulation.

Acclimation procedures significantly impact survival rates for newly acquired specimens. Drip acclimation over 1 to 2 hours allows gradual adjustment to destination water chemistry, minimizing osmotic shock. Quarantine new arrivals for 4 to 6 weeks before main display introduction, observing for disease and allowing recovery from shipping stress.

Coral Beauty Angelfish Health & Lifespan

Coral Beauty Angelfish rank among the hardiest dwarf angelfish species available to marine aquarists, demonstrating resilience uncommon in the Centropyge genus. When properly maintained in stable, well-filtered systems, these fish commonly survive 10 to 15 years in captivity, with exceptional specimens occasionally exceeding this range. Their robust constitution makes them excellent choices for aquarists graduating from freshwater to marine fishkeeping, though attention to disease prevention remains important for long-term success.

With proper quarantine, stable conditions, and appropriate nutrition, Coral Beauty Angelfish prove remarkably resistant to common marine diseases. Their hardiness among dwarf angelfish makes them forgiving of minor husbandry errors while rewarding conscientious care with long lives and vibrant health. Regular observation during daily feeding helps identify early disease signs when treatment proves most effective.

Common Health Issues

  • Marine ich - Cryptocaryon irritans, presents as white spots on body and fins, particularly common during acclimation stress or temperature fluctuations, requiring copper treatment or hyposalinity therapy in quarantine systems.
  • Marine velvet - Amyloodinium ocellatum, causes rapid respiratory distress with fine gold-dust appearance on skin, progressing quickly and requiring immediate copper treatment to prevent mortality.
  • Head and lateral line erosion - HLLE, manifests as pitting around the face and sensory organs, typically resulting from nutritional deficiencies or poor water quality, responding to improved diet and water conditions.
  • Lymphocystis appears as cauliflower-like growths on fins and body caused by viral infection - Generally resolving without treatment over weeks to months when water quality remains excellent.
  • Internal parasites cause gradual weight loss despite normal feeding behavior - Often introduced through live foods or wild-caught specimens, treatable with medicated foods containing metronidazole or praziquantel.
  • Bacterial infections following injury or stress manifest as reddened areas - Fin deterioration, or cloudy eyes, requiring antibiotic treatment and improved water quality to resolve effectively.

Preventive Care & Health Monitoring

  • Quarantine all new fish for 4 to 6 weeks in a separate treatment-capable system - Observing for disease signs and allowing recovery from collection and shipping stress before main display introduction.
  • Maintain stable water parameters through regular testing - Quality equipment, and consistent maintenance schedules, preventing the stress fluctuations that trigger disease outbreaks in vulnerable fish.
  • Provide varied, vitamin-enriched nutrition including spirulina preparations - Frozen foods, and quality pellets to support immune function and prevent nutritional deficiencies causing HLLE.
  • Minimize stress through appropriate tank size - Compatible tank mates, adequate hiding spots, and avoiding unnecessary disturbances to the aquarium environment.

Coral Beauty Angelfish Feeding & Diet

Coral Beauty Angelfish demonstrate omnivorous feeding habits in nature, consuming a combination of algae, small invertebrates, and organic detritus found across reef surfaces. Replicating this varied diet in captivity supports health, coloration, and longevity while encouraging natural grazing behaviors that keep these fish active and engaged throughout the day.

The foundation of captive nutrition should consist of quality spirulina-based preparations addressing the significant algae component of their natural diet. Spirulina flakes, pellets, and frozen preparations provide essential nutrients while satisfying grazing instincts. Nori seaweed sheets attached to clips offer extended grazing opportunities, keeping fish occupied while providing beneficial fiber and vitamins.

Protein sources prove equally important for balanced nutrition. Frozen mysis shrimp, brine shrimp, and finely chopped seafood provide essential amino acids supporting growth and color development. Vitamin-enriched frozen preparations ensure complete nutrition, with products specifically formulated for marine angelfish offering optimal ingredient profiles for this species.

Quality marine pellets serve as convenient staple foods, with formulations designed for dwarf angelfish providing appropriate nutrition in stable, easily stored formats. Select pellets sized appropriately for the fish's mouth, avoiding pieces too large to consume easily. Soak pellets briefly before feeding to aid digestion and reduce air intake.

Feeding frequency matters significantly for this constantly grazing species. Rather than one or two large daily feedings, offer small portions three to four times throughout the day when possible. This schedule better approximates natural feeding patterns while preventing water quality degradation from uneaten food accumulation. Automatic feeders can maintain feeding schedules during absence.

Live foods provide excellent enrichment and stimulate natural foraging behavior, though they carry disease transmission risks without proper sourcing. Enriched brine shrimp, copepods, and amphipods from established refugiums offer safe live food options that also help control nuisance algae populations. These foods prove particularly valuable for encouraging feeding in newly acquired or finicky specimens.

Monitor body condition regularly, adjusting feeding amounts to prevent both underfeeding and obesity. A slightly rounded belly after feeding indicates appropriate portions, while visible ribs or sunken appearance suggests inadequate nutrition. Conversely, persistently distended abdomens may indicate overfeeding or internal issues requiring attention.

Tank Mates & Breeding

Selecting appropriate tank mates for Coral Beauty Angelfish requires understanding their semi-aggressive nature and territorial tendencies. Success comes from choosing species that occupy different ecological niches, avoiding direct competition for territory or resources while creating visually diverse community displays. Careful planning prevents conflicts that stress fish and diminish display appeal.

Excellent companions include clownfish species, which remain largely in upper water column areas around host anemones or substitute corals. Damselfish other than highly aggressive species coexist well, as do most wrasses that spend time hunting invertebrates across rock surfaces. Gobies and blennies occupying sand beds or specific rock perches rarely conflict with angelfish territories.

Tangs and surgeonfish generally make compatible tank mates, with their open-water swimming habits and primarily herbivorous diet reducing competition. Size-appropriate species like Yellow Tangs or Kole Tangs work well in sufficiently large systems. Very large or aggressive tang species may intimidate Coral Beauties, requiring careful observation during introduction.

Avoid housing Coral Beauties with other dwarf angelfish species unless tank size exceeds 150 gallons with multiple distinct territories. The territorial aggression between Centropyge species typically proves relentless, stressing subordinate individuals regardless of prior residency or introduction order. Even species with different appearances trigger competitive responses.

Larger angelfish from the Pomacanthus genus generally ignore dwarf angels, though crowding in insufficiently sized systems creates problems. Triggers, large wrasses, and aggressive dottybacks may bully Coral Beauties, particularly during feeding. Avoid known predators of small fish, including lionfish, groupers, and larger eels that might view dwarf angelfish as food.

Regarding reef compatibility, Coral Beauties present moderate risk to certain invertebrates. They typically ignore soft corals and most LPS species, though individual specimens occasionally develop nipping habits toward fleshy corals or clam mantles. Observing behavior during initial introduction allows intervention before significant damage occurs. Some aquarists report successful long-term reef keeping while others experience problematic nipping, suggesting individual variation in behavior.

Breeding in home aquaria remains exceptionally rare, as establishing compatible pairs proves difficult and larval rearing nearly impossible without specialized facilities. For those interested, purchasing established pairs from specialty breeders offers the best success opportunity, though dedicated breeding setups remain necessary for any fry survival chance.
